A tech millionaire died in a highway plane crash. Brave strangers saved the other five.

A private jet crashed upside down on a Texas road, killing Austin startup leader Joshua Baer while local heroes rescued five survivors.

When a plane starts to fall from the sky, we trust the pilots and the machines to keep us safe. But when a flight goes wrong on a dark highway, the line between life and death comes down to the courage of strangers on the ground.

WHAT HAPPENED

On Tuesday night, a private jet carrying six people crashed on Texas State Highway Loop 20 near the Mexico border. The plane hit the road upside down around 10 p.m. and burst into flames, throwing metal across the lanes and hitting a car.

Joshua Baer, a well-known tech leader from Austin, died in the crash. He was the head of Capital Factory, a group that helps new businesses grow.

Five other people on the plane survived. Brave people ran to the burning wreck with a sledgehammer and a shovel to smash the glass and pull them out.

WHAT THE EVIDENCE SHOWS

The jet was a Cessna Latitude run by NetJets.

  • The flight left Mexico at 6:18 p.m. and was headed to Austin.
  • Tower workers said the plane had an engine issue before they lost contact.
  • Five passengers survived the crash along with one person in a car.
  • Five rescue workers had to go to the hospital for breathing in smoke.

THE OTHER SIDE

NetJets and the plane crew have not blamed anyone for the crash yet. They are working with federal safety teams to find out what went wrong.

Since these safety tests take a long time, we cannot know who was at fault yet.

WHAT HAPPENS NOW

Federal teams are looking into the crash. The road will need repairs, and local leaders are mourning a major figure in the Texas business world.
